Drops the cuaverifierbench/ build script (now hosted alongside the dataset on HuggingFace) and checks in a full WebTailBench trajectory under webeval/data/example_trajectory/ (web_surfer.log, final_answer, screenshots, core.log, times.json, task_data.json, rubric score file). webeval/README.md now walks through each file against that concrete example and corrects several field-level inaccuracies (times.json keys, emitted event types, webtailbench score payload, auto-0 vs excluded semantics). Adds test_trajectory_loading and test_verify_trajectories coverage; repairs HuggingFace dataset URLs and doubled /path/to paths in the root README. """Tests for ``webeval.trajectory.Trajectory`` against the bundled
|
|
example trajectory at ``webeval/data/example_trajectory``.
|
|
|
|
The example is a real WebTailBench run (``alltrails_find_23``) checked
|
|
into the repo so the loader has a stable fixture — no network access,
|
|
no LLM calls, no hard-coded absolute paths.
|
|
"""
|
|
|
|
from __future__ import annotations
|
|
|
|
from pathlib import Path
|
|
|
|
import pytest
|
|
|
|
|
|
EXAMPLE_TRAJECTORY_DIR = (
|
|
Path(__file__).resolve().parent.parent / "data" / "example_trajectory"
|
|
)
|
|
|
|
|
|
@pytest.fixture(scope="module")
|
|
def example_traj_path() -> Path:
|
|
assert EXAMPLE_TRAJECTORY_DIR.is_dir(), (
|
|
f"Missing fixture dir: {EXAMPLE_TRAJECTORY_DIR}"
|
|
)
|
|
return EXAMPLE_TRAJECTORY_DIR
|
|
|
|
|
|
def test_required_trajectory_files_present(example_traj_path: Path):
|
|
"""The fixture dir must contain the file set the current webeval
|
|
pipeline produces — ``verify_trajectories.find_trajectory_dirs``
|
|
keys off ``web_surfer.log`` + ``*_final_answer.json``.
|
|
"""
|
|
assert (example_traj_path / "web_surfer.log").exists()
|
|
assert (example_traj_path / "core.log").exists()
|
|
assert (example_traj_path / "times.json").exists()
|
|
assert (example_traj_path / "task_data.json").exists()
|
|
|
|
answer_files = list(example_traj_path.glob("*_final_answer.json"))
|
|
assert len(answer_files) == 1, f"expected 1 final-answer file, got {answer_files}"
|
|
|
|
screenshots = sorted(example_traj_path.glob("screenshot_*.png"))
|
|
assert len(screenshots) >= 1
|
|
|
|
scores = list((example_traj_path / "scores").glob("*.json"))
|
|
assert len(scores) >= 1
|
|
|
|
|
|
def test_from_folder_returns_none_on_missing_log(tmp_path: Path):
|
|
"""``Trajectory.from_folder`` swallows exceptions and returns None;
|
|
an empty dir has no web_surfer.log, so the call must not raise."""
|
|
from webeval.trajectory import Trajectory
|
|
|
|
assert Trajectory.from_folder(tmp_path) is None
|
|
|
|
|
|
def test_from_folder_loads_example_trajectory(example_traj_path: Path):
|
|
"""Real trajectory must load, parse events, and resolve screenshot
|
|
paths relative to the trajectory directory."""
|
|
from webeval.trajectory import Trajectory
|
|
|
|
traj = Trajectory.from_folder(example_traj_path, gpt_solver=True)
|
|
assert traj is not None, "from_folder returned None on a valid trajectory"
|
|
|
|
# web_surfer.log has interleaved SummarizedAction (action=null) and
|
|
# WebSurfer (actual action) rows. With gpt_solver=True the loader
|
|
# filters to source==WebSurfer AND action!=null → exactly one event
|
|
# per taken step. The example has 4 steps.
|
|
assert len(traj.events) == 4
|
|
action_names = [e.get("action") for e in traj.events]
|
|
assert action_names == [
|
|
"input_text",
|
|
"click",
|
|
"pause_and_memorize_fact",
|
|
"stop_and_answer_question",
|
|
]
|
|
|
|
# FinalAnswer was loaded from the *_final_answer.json file.
|
|
assert traj.answer is not None
|
|
assert traj.answer.final_answer.startswith("The two standout waterfalls")
|
|
assert not traj.is_aborted
|
|
|
|
# Screenshots listed in the answer JSON are resolved to abs paths
|
|
# rooted at the trajectory dir (is_rel_paths=True → joined in __init__).
|
|
assert len(traj.screenshots) == 4
|
|
for s in traj.screenshots:
|
|
p = Path(s)
|
|
assert p.is_absolute(), f"screenshot path should be absolute: {s}"
|
|
assert p.parent == example_traj_path
|
|
assert p.name.startswith("screenshot_") and p.name.endswith(".png")
|
|
assert p.exists(), f"screenshot file missing: {p}"
|
|
|
|
|
|
def test_repr_describes_screenshots_and_actions(example_traj_path: Path):
|
|
"""``repr(Trajectory)`` reports the counts debugging scripts rely on."""
|
|
from webeval.trajectory import Trajectory
|
|
|
|
traj = Trajectory.from_folder(example_traj_path, gpt_solver=True)
|
|
assert traj is not None
|
|
r = repr(traj)
|
|
assert "4 screenshots" in r
|
|
# gpt_solver=True short-circuits actions/thoughts construction, so
|
|
# the "actions" count in repr is 0 in this mode — verify stable.
|
|
assert "0 actions" in r
|
|
|
|
|
|
if __name__ == "__main__":
|
|
# Keep the old ad-hoc behaviour: running this file directly prints a
|
|
# human-readable summary of the example trajectory. Useful for
|
|
# eyeballing parse output without pytest.
|
|
import sys
|
|
|
|
sys.path.insert(0, str(Path(__file__).resolve().parent.parent / "src"))
|
|
from webeval.trajectory import Trajectory
|
|
|
|
traj = Trajectory(EXAMPLE_TRAJECTORY_DIR, gpt_solver=True)
|
|
print(repr(traj))
|
|
print(f"events: {len(traj.events)}")
|
|
print(f"screenshots: {len(traj.screenshots)}")
|
|
print(f"answer: {traj.answer.final_answer[:120]}...")
|
